Redtail Golf Club is an 18-hole public golf course situated in the Village of Lakewood, Illinois. Designed by Roger Packard in 1992, the course features bent grass greens and fairways. The facility offers a driving range and golf school with teaching professionals on staff. Walking is not permitted on the course, indicating cart usage is required for play. Located in northeastern Illinois, Redtail Golf Club provides golfers with a structured playing environment and instructional opportunities for players seeking to improve their skills or enjoy a round of golf in a managed setting.
